Seriously you need to give this method up. Your coming across the ball quite alot and in order to try and keep a straight path you are not rotating onto your left side, keeping your weight back and tilting back to try and correct your path. You need to stop doing this before it becomes a habit you cant get rid of.

I get you idolise Moe Norman but believe it or not Moe aas very flexible and pretty athletic as a youngster he had quick hips which allowed him to swing the way he did. For your average guy of average flexibility and athletic ability, it's just not going to be a swing which you can make work. Go to a respected PGA pro in your area, you will make real improvements

With all the practice you have done you have done, this is what I see.

Poor address position
Strong grip
Inconsistent ball position
Cluface closed on the backswing
Very little wrist hinge
Throw at the top of the (half) backswing
Out to in downswing
Right side collapses through impact
No footwork
No weight transfer
Hips haven't cleared through impact
Poor balance

You need to start practicing good things, not bad things
